Selecting the Perfect Shoes for Work
Finding the right footwear can really make or break your workday. When it comes to shoes for work, you need a pair that is both appropriate and comfortable.
Consider the type of work you do. If you're on your feet all day, you'll want something with good cushioning. For office jobs, a more refined style might be preferable.
Don't forget to include the dress code. Some workplaces have strict regulations on shoe wear. It's always best to err on the side of caution and choose something professional.
When it comes to choosing work shoes, there are a few key things to bear in mind. Initially, make sure the shoes fit well. You don't want them to be too tight or too loose. , Also think about the texture of the shoe. Leather is a classic choice that is both stylish and durable. Canvas is a more casual option, while suede can add a touch of class. Finally, don't forget to pick shoes that are comfortable to wear. You'll be spending a lot of time in them, so it's important to make sure they feel good on your feet.
